When a twelve year-old supervillain wannabe and his friends get stranded on a desolate planet, it’s up to his younger sister to bring them back to prevent a dangerous intergalactic threat. That is, if she decides to help. Don’t miss the last installment of the Steve L. McEvil series!
Move aside Steve, Eve is the new villain in town!
After being sucked into a wormhole, supervillain-in training Steve L. McEvil and his friends find themselves stranded in space! But with their new alien friend Lux, they might just find a way to stop the evil Perses from destroying Earth. If they manage to get home first.
Back on Earth, Eve is ready to enact her evil plans and finally be seen as the real supervillain in her family. When Gramps comes to her for help, Eve’s first instinct is to say no. But the glory of rubbing it in Steve’s face might just be enough for Eve to help bring him home in time to stop Perses.
Steve L. McEvil and The Twister Sister is the hilarious final installment in this humorous superhero series about friendship, standing up for other, and being true to yourself.

Author
Lucas Turnbloom
Lucas Turnbloom is the award-winning cowriter and illustrator of the Dream Jumper series, Nightmare Escape and Curse of the Harvester, and the creator of the How to Cat and Imagine This comic strips. He and his family make their home in San Diego.
